How Arborists Inspect Tree Health for Trimming

How do arborists assess the condition of a tree before pruning? Their evaluation starts with a visual inspection, concentrating on the tree's overall structure, leaf condition, and any indicators of illness or pest infestation. Arborists inspect the trunk for splits, deterioration, or cankers, which can suggest underlying wellness concerns. They also assess the root system to guarantee firmness and proper nutrient uptake.

Next, they examine the tree's age and species, as different types have specific growth patterns and needs. Arborists take into account environmental factors, such as soil quality, light exposure, and surrounding vegetation, which can affect tree health.

In conclusion, they could use tools like soil tests or bark probes to uncover deeper understanding. This meticulous assessment permits arborists to make informed decisions about trimming, guaranteeing each cut fosters the tree's vitality and durability while beautifying the overall landscape.

Popular Tree Trimming Techniques You Ought to Know

Tree trimming employs various methods designed to promote vitality and visual beauty. One common method is crown thinning, which involves selectively removing branches to enhance sunlight exposure and airflow within the tree. This technique improves overall health while preserving the tree's natural shape. Another common approach is crown reduction, used to lower the height of a tree while maintaining its structure. This is particularly advantageous for trees that present a risk to nearby structures. Additionally, the technique of deadwooding concentrates on eliminating dead or diseased branches, stopping the spread of pests and diseases. Finally, directional pruning encourages growth in specific directions, allowing for improved landscape design and preventing obstructions. Understanding these techniques enables property owners to make informed decisions about their tree care, ensuring a healthier and more visually attractive landscape.

How Consistently Should I Schedule Tree Trimming Services?

Tree trimming services essential information should typically be scheduled every 1 to 3 years, depending on the tree type, growth rate, and local climate conditions. Regular assessments can support the maintenance of tree health and avoid potential hazards.

Determining the Top Timeframe for Tree Trimming

The optimal time to cut back trees is late winter to early spring, prior to new growth begins. This approach minimizes pressure on the trees and enables faster recovery, promoting stronger and more robust growth later.

Will Tree Trimming Harm My Trees?

Trimming trees can harm them if done too frequently or incorrectly, leading to strain, illness, or framework problems. However, when executed properly and at right moments, it boosts health and longevity in trees. Proper techniques are essential.

Do I have to Be Home While the Trimming takes place?

A homeowner's presence during tree trimming is commonly not mandatory. Professionals can manage the job independently with skill, ensuring quality and safety standards. However, some may want to be present for communication and to address concerns directly.

What Is the Typical Cost of Expert Tree Trimming?

Professional tree trimming services generally costs between $200 and $1,500, depending on factors like tree size, location, and complexity of the job. Additional fees may apply for specialized services or emergency requests.
